Find two positive numbers whose product is 64 and whose sum is a minimum. (If both values are the same number, enter it into bot

h blanks.) (smaller number) (larger number)
Mathematics
1 answer:
bekas [8.4K]3 years ago
7 0

Answer:

Both the numbers are 8.

Step-by-step explanation:

Let the two numbers are p and 64/p.

The sum is given by

S = p +\frac{64}{p}\\\\\frac{dS}{dp}= 1 - \frac{64}{p^2}\\\\\frac{dS}{dp}=0\\\\\frac{64}{p^2}=1\\\\p= \pm 8

So, the sum is minimum for p = 8 0r - 8, so the two numbers 8.

Identify the zeros of the function f(x) =2x^2 − 2x + 13 using the Quadratic Formula. SHOW WORK PLEASE!! I NEED HELP!!
babunello [35]

Answer:

x=\frac{1+5i} {2}   and  x=\frac{1-5i} {2}

Step-by-step explanation:

we know that

The formula to solve a quadratic equation of the form

ax^{2} +bx+c=0

is equal to

x=\frac{-b\pm\sqrt{b^{2}-4ac}} {2a}

in this problem we have

f(x)=2x^{2} -2x+13  

Equate the function to zero

2x^{2} -2x+13=0  

so

a=2\\b=-2\\c=13

substitute in the formula

x=\frac{-(-2)\pm\sqrt{-2^{2}-4(2)(13)}} {2(2)}

x=\frac{2\pm\sqrt{-100}} {4}

Remember that

i=\sqrt{-1}

so

x=\frac{2\pm10i} {4}

Simplify

x=\frac{1\pm5i} {2}

therefore

x=\frac{1+5i} {2}   and  x=\frac{1-5i} {2}
